  • 4/5 Dr. Sarath Withanarachchi S. 4 years ago on Google
    The market has shops erected on eirher side of a tribute of a river and visitors can go for a boat ride. In addition, the market is full of food stalls and sovenior shops selling number of items. This market is one of the tourist attractions in Ayutthaya and it is worth visiting.

  • 5/5 Chaiyasak P. 4 years ago on Google
    Nice floating market where you can walk and look things. You can also find local foods here. There is a show about historical of Ayutthaya. A lot of parking space provide but you have to pay 40 THB. Foods here are not expensive than outside. Good for walking on holiday. By the way in summer wil be little hot.

  • 5/5 Jai C. 3 years ago on Google
    TW: real guns, real knives, gunshots, fake blood, extreme violence. The show was very good. Very interesting. But, it is a show about invaders battling natives. They do not hide or diminish the violence of this event. I do recommend seeing the show. Just be aware. I was expecting maybe some native dance and singing. Not a historical play.
